after installing SP3 I am unable to fully load windows. I get the screen
that asks what OS I am using. I choose Windows XP Home edition. Then it
goes to screen where there is choices like Safe Mode, Safe Mode Networking,
Last know good configuration, start windows normally. I am only able to go
to the safe modes. But what then...?? How do I fix this? Help! Why does
windows update recommend you to install this SP if there is issues?

Run a system restore from 'Safe Mode With Command Prompt':

HOW TO Start System Restore Tool from Command Prompt (Q304449):
